发明名称 |
一种电路仿真模拟同步波形压缩格式 |
摘要 |
随着集成电路规模的急剧增加,电路仿真验证所产生的波形文件也越来越大。实际电路设计中,可能还需要对电路进行多次仿真以优化电路,所需存储的波形数据就更为庞大。因此,在不影响数据精度的前提下,对波形进行快速压缩,以降低数据存储量,对于实际电路设计具有重要意义。本发明基于一种高效的时间片压缩方法,提出了适用于该方法的波形文件存储格式,并定义了波形文件的文件头格式以及数据的存放方式。在实际工程应用中,此格式能够很好地满足大规模集成电路仿真对存储空间的要求,极大地提高了设计效率。 |
申请公布号 |
CN103853855A |
申请公布日期 |
2014.06.11 |
申请号 |
CN201210497549.7 |
申请日期 |
2012.11.29 |
申请人 |
北京华大九天软件有限公司 |
发明人 |
郭根华;宋德强;吴跃波;张卫卫 |
分类号 |
G06F17/50(2006.01)I;G06F17/30(2006.01)I |
主分类号 |
G06F17/50(2006.01)I |
代理机构 |
|
代理人 |
|
主权项 |
一种电路仿真模拟同步波形压缩格式,其技术特征在于包含以下步骤:①设置信号相关的信息以及与压缩相关的参数,并写入文件头;②以Table为单位,按块状分别存储数据;③根据文件头设置的压缩参数,将每个Table划分若干时间片;④将每个时间片分为参考帧(I帧)和比较帧(P帧);⑤对I帧,直接编码,然后写入文件;⑥对P帧,计算帧间残差、量化,用ZLib进行压缩编码,然后写入文件;⑦循环重复②‑⑥中各步骤,直到所有Table中的所有时间片数据都写入完毕。 |
地址 |
100102 北京市朝阳区利泽中二路2号A座二层 |